Understanding CRM in Digital Marketing

Customer Relationship Management, or CRM, stands as a cornerstone in digital marketing, enabling businesses to manage interactions with current and potential customers systematically. In the context of digital marketing, CRM refers to the strategies, practices, and technologies that companies use to analyze customer data and interactions across various digital channels. This approach allows marketers to personalize communications, streamline sales processes, and foster long-term customer loyalty. For digital marketers, business owners, and agencies, grasping CRM’s role is essential, as it transforms raw data into actionable insights that drive revenue and improve customer satisfaction.

At its core, CRM in digital marketing integrates customer information from sources such as email campaigns, social media engagements, website analytics, and e-commerce transactions. This unified view empowers teams to create targeted marketing initiatives that resonate with individual preferences and behaviors. Unlike traditional marketing, which often relies on broad demographics, CRM leverages digital tools to deliver precision. For instance, by tracking user journeys through digital touchpoints, marketers can identify opportunities for upselling or re-engagement, ultimately boosting conversion rates. As digital landscapes evolve, CRM ensures that marketing efforts remain customer-centric, aligning with the expectations of modern consumers who demand relevance and timeliness in their interactions.

The Fundamentals of CRM Systems

Defining Key Components

CRM systems encompass software solutions designed to capture, store, and analyze customer data. Core components include contact management, which organizes customer profiles with details like preferences and purchase history; lead scoring, which prioritizes prospects based on engagement levels; and reporting tools that generate insights into campaign performance. These elements work together to support digital marketing objectives, ensuring that every interaction contributes to a comprehensive customer view.

Evolution from Traditional to Digital CRM

Historically, CRM focused on sales teams using spreadsheets and phone logs. In digital marketing, it has evolved to incorporate online behaviors, such as click-through rates and social interactions. This shift allows for real-time data processing, enabling marketers to adapt strategies on the fly. Business owners benefit from this agility, as it minimizes wasted ad spend and maximizes outreach effectiveness.

Leveraging Digital Marketing Automation Through CRM

Core Features of Digital Marketing Automation

Digital marketing automation, powered by CRM, automates repetitive tasks such as email nurturing, lead qualification, and content personalization. Tools within CRM systems trigger actions based on user behavior, like sending follow-up emails after website visits. This not only scales marketing efforts but also ensures consistency in messaging across touchpoints.

Impact on Campaign Efficiency

For agencies, automation integrated with CRM reduces campaign deployment time from weeks to days, allowing focus on creative strategy. Business owners see improved ROI through higher engagement rates, as automated sequences deliver timely, relevant content that nurtures leads into loyal customers.

Measuring Success and ROI in CRM-Enabled Digital Marketing

Key Performance Indicators

Success metrics include customer lifetime value, churn rate, and conversion attribution. CRM dashboards provide visualizations of these KPIs, enabling precise tracking of digital marketing impact. Agencies use this data to demonstrate value to clients through detailed reports.

Optimization Techniques

Regular audits of CRM data reveal bottlenecks, such as low engagement segments, prompting targeted optimizations. Techniques like A/B testing within CRM environments refine tactics, ensuring continuous improvement in digital marketing performance.

What Are Common Challenges in Implementing CRM for Digital Marketing?

Common challenges include data integration issues, user adoption resistance, and ensuring data quality. Overcoming these requires thorough training, selecting compatible platforms, and establishing governance policies to maintain accurate, actionable data.

How Do You Choose the Right CRM System for Digital Marketing?

Choosing a CRM involves assessing needs like automation capabilities, integration with existing tools, and scalability. Evaluate user reviews, trial periods, and vendor support to ensure the system aligns with digital marketing goals and budget constraints.
